    Potato Bake (not packet mix)

    I have heaps of potatoes that need using up, so thought I'd make a potato bake. I've only ever used the packet mixes in the past, but would like to have a go making one without.

    So, how do I go about making a potato bake?

    I don't have a set recipe for mine, but I usually mix up a big bowl that is 2/3 cream and 1/3 milk, with some nutmeg in it. Spread a layer of potato, sprinkle some bacon pieces, then cover with the cream/milk. Keep going until your dish is full (but not too full or the liquid spills over while baking), then sprinkle with a little more nutmeg and cheese.     I usually do:
    layer of potato topped by diced bacon and onion and salt and pepper, covered in cream and then repeat. The final layer I add a bit of grated cheese. What is also nice is if you have either some garlic or garlic powder then you can add that in with it - not too much tho.

    Sliced potatos, sliced onion, cream, salt n pepper, nutmeg if you like.

    Layer potatoes and onions, cover with seasoned cream, bsake in the hot oven until cooked.
    Just before it is ready, cheese and chives over the top until melted and golden.
